The silence in Lagos was shattered by the screech of metal on asphalt. A routine drive, a moment of respite for Anthony Joshua just nine days after his victory over Jake Paul, had turned into a nightmare. The Lexus Jeep, carrying the boxing star, collided with a stationary truck on the Lagos-Ibadan Expressway, forever altering the course of several lives.

The immediate aftermath was chaos. Joshua, visibly shaken and injured, was carefully extracted from the wreckage. But the true devastation lay in the loss of two men who were far more than just part of his entourage – Sina Ghami and Kevin Latif Ayodele, close friends and integral members of Joshua’s inner circle, were gone.

News of the tragedy reached President Bola Ahmed Tinubu, who immediately extended his condolences and spoke directly with Joshua. He found a champion grappling with unimaginable grief, assured of the best possible medical care, yet profoundly impacted by the sudden loss. The President also spoke with Joshua’s mother, Yeta Odusanya, who had rushed to her son’s side.

Hours before the crash, a video surfaced – a simple, joyful moment of Joshua and Ayodele, affectionately known as ‘Latz,’ sharing a game of table tennis. Laughter filled the frame, a stark contrast to the sorrow that would soon engulf them. Ayodele, a dedicated personal trainer and a man who found solace in his faith, had been a constant presence in Joshua’s journey since his first world title win in 2016.

Sina Ghami, Joshua’s strength and conditioning coach for over a decade, was the other life lost. He wasn’t just a trainer; he was a specialist in musculoskeletal injuries, a co-founder of Evolve Gym, and a steadfast companion through Joshua’s most defining moments, including the epic battle against Wladimir Klitschko at Wembley. His last social media post, a glimpse of Joshua’s motorcade through Lagos, now carries a heartbreaking weight.

Initial reports suggested minor injuries for Joshua, but concerns linger about the extent of his condition. He remains under observation at Duchess International Hospital in Lagos, while those around him, including Governor Dapo Abiodun, work to ensure he receives the best possible attention. The tragedy resonated far beyond the boxing ring. Jake Paul, Joshua’s recent opponent, offered his condolences, acknowledging the fragility of life and the importance of those lost. The outpouring of grief speaks to the profound impact Ghami and Ayodele had on those who knew them, and the deep respect they commanded within Joshua’s team.

President Tinubu, in a heartfelt message, extended his prayers to the families and friends of both men, acknowledging the immense pain of their untimely passing.
